“Dhol tasha is claimed to happen to be an integral Component of Maharashtra from your medieval period of time. The dhol (double-headed drum) was also used to stimulate the troupes during wars,” states Parag Thakur, president of Dhol tasha mahasangh Maharashtra.

Tassa is definitely an Indo-Caribbean musical genre well-known in Trinidad and Tobago characterized by a four-component ensemble comprising four devices: two small kettledrums called “tassa,” a double-headed bass drum known as dhol or just “bass,” and jhal, a list of hand cymbals.
